Baked Nacho Casserole Recipe

Baked Nacho Casserole Recipe

Yield: 9x13 dish
Prep Time: 35 minutes
Cook Time: 25 minutes
Total Time: 1 hour

Baked Nacho Casserole

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 cup sour cream, divided
  • 1/4 cup of water
  • taco seasoning mix
  • 3-4 roma tomatoes, diced
  • 1 green bell pepper, diced
  • 1 cup corn
  • 1/3 cup red onion, diced
  • 2 1/2 cups Mexican cheese blend
  • 1 bag of tortilla chips
  • 2 green onions, diced

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350
  2. Brown 1 pound of beef over stovetop. Drain if excess fat.
  3. Add 1/4 cup water, 1/3 cup sour cream, taco seasoning and stir.
  4. Add diced tomatoes, corn, green bell pepper, onion and stir. Let simmer for 5 minutes. Salt to taste.
  5. Spray casserole dish with cooking spray and add a layer of tortilla chips on the base.
  6. Add a layer of meat and top with a layer of cheese blend.
  7. Repeat with another layer of meat mix and cheese blend.
  8. Cook for 20 minutes.
  9. Remove, add an additional layer of chips in a circle in the middle and top with extra cheese blend.
  10. Cook for another 5 minutes.
  11. Remove from oven, top with remaining sour cream, sprinkle with green onions and serve!
